Understanding Insurance Endorsements: Modifying Your Existing Policy In the dynamic landscape of risk and personal circumstances, the insurance policy you purchased last year may not perfectly fit your needs today

This is where insurance endorsements—also known as riders or amendments—become essential tools for policyholders. An endorsement is a formal document that changes the terms and conditions of an existing insurance contract, allowing for customization without the need to purchase an entirely new policy.

An insurance endorsement is a written amendment attached to your original policy contract. It can add, remove, or alter coverage. Think of it as a tailored adjustment to the standard “off-the-rack” policy, ensuring your coverage aligns precisely with your evolving situation.

Common Types of Endorsements

Endorsements can serve various purposes across different insurance lines:

In Property & Casualty Insurance:
* Adding a Driver or Vehicle: On an auto policy.
* Scheduled Personal Property: Adding specific high-value items (e.g., jewelry, art) to a homeowners policy with agreed value coverage.
* Business Use Endorsement: Modifying a personal auto policy to cover business-related driving.
* Water Backup Coverage: Adding protection for damage caused by sewer or drain backup to a homeowners policy.

In Life & Health Insurance:
* Waiver of Premium: Waives premium payments if the insured becomes disabled.
* Accidental Death Benefit: Provides an additional payout if death results from an accident.
* Critical Illness Rider: Provides a lump-sum payment upon diagnosis of a specified illness.

Why Endorsements Are Crucial

  • 1. Adapts to Life Changes::
  • Marriage, a new home, a home-based business, or the purchase of expensive equipment all necessitate a review of your coverage. Endorsements allow your policy to evolve with you.

  • 2. Fills Coverage Gaps::
  • Standard policies have exclusions. Endorsements can close these gaps, providing protection for unique risks not covered in the base contract.

  • 3. Cost-Effective Customization::
  • It is generally more affordable to endorse an existing policy than to purchase a separate, specialized policy for a new need.

  • 4. Clarity and Certainty::
  • The endorsement becomes a legally binding part of your contract, eliminating ambiguity about what is and isn’t covered in specific scenarios.

    The Process of Changing Your Policy

    Implementing an endorsement typically follows a structured process:

  • 1. Request::
  • You or your insurance agent/broker identifies a need for a change and contacts the insurance company.

  • 2. Underwriting Review::
  • The insurer assesses the new risk. This may involve questions, a new application, or an inspection. For some simple changes, this step is minimal.

  • 3. Approval & Pricing::
  • The insurer approves or denies the request. If approved, they calculate any additional premium (or potential refund) based on the change in risk.

  • 4. Issuance::
  • The company issues the formal endorsement document. It is critical to review this document carefully to ensure the changes are accurately reflected.

  • 5. Integration::
  • File the endorsement with your original policy documents. The effective date of the change will be stated on the endorsement.

    Key Considerations and Best Practices

    * Proactive Review: Conduct an annual review of your policies with your insurance advisor. Discuss any life or business changes to identify necessary endorsements.
    * Understand the Impact: Ask how the endorsement affects your premium, deductibles, and overall coverage limits.
    * Get it in Writing: Never assume a verbal conversation changes your policy. The endorsement is not effective until you receive and accept the written document.
    * No “Automatic” Changes: Your policy does not automatically adjust to your changing circumstances. The responsibility to request updates lies with the policyholder.
    * Consult a Professional: Insurance agents and brokers are invaluable in helping you understand available endorsements and which are appropriate for your specific risks.
